Scuola Estiva presents a rather provocative take on summer school life, where the intertwining stories of young adult girls unfold amidst carefree days and sultry nights. The film captures a raw, almost palpable atmosphere, laced with a sense of rebellion and exploration. It leans heavily into themes of sexuality and self-discovery, often blurring the lines between innocence and desire. While the performances can be a bit uneven, there's an honest energy that comes through, particularly in the camaraderie among the leads. The practical effects are minimal, but the cinematography does a decent job of capturing those sweltering summer vibes, making it feel somewhat immersive. It's not your typical coming-of-age, that's for sure.
Scuola Estiva has become somewhat of a curiosity for collectors, mainly due to the elusive nature of its director and the lack of extensive marketing. Formats are limited, with few official releases, making it a rare find among similar films. The thematic content and unique approach to teenage life have sparked interest among niche collectors who appreciate this blend of coming-of-age and adult themes, though its scarcity adds a layer of intrigue. Overall, it's a title that appeals to those seeking something distinct within the genre.
